NATURAL BUILDING WITH BAMBOO\nBamboo is an eco-friendly natural resource known for its rapid growth. As a core component of the workshop, participants will gain the basic knowledge, skills and practice needed for bamboo construction, as well as technologies that use bamboo in combination with other materials.  Sessions include:\n\nTheory and practice of working with bamboo\nTreating bamboo against insects\nBamboo carpentry: bending, cutting, joineries, split and weave bamboo\nBamboo construction\n\nAfter learning basic skills in bamboo technology, participants will help in making a bamboo structure and learn the know-how of building construction. \n2. POURED MUD CONCRETE\nUnderstanding material characterization is extremely important for implementing proper interventions; however there is a step between material diagnosis and treatment: suitability of the material—in this case the soil—to be used for the original construction of a particular site. \nPoured Mud Concrete is presently underutilized, and has great potential for poured foundations, walls, slabs and beams, and roads. Poured Earth Concrete mixes that achieve desired flow characteristics, while maintaining dry and wet strength, low water absorption, and low shrinkage.
